The Importance of Filters

Why You Need a Filter

Engine filters are essential in keeping your engine healthy. They trap dirt and debris, preventing it from entering the engine. This protection enhances performance and ensures a longer engine life. Diesel engines face unique challenges that make a specific diesel filter essential for optimal operation.

The Role of a Diesel Filter

A diesel filter plays a vital role in the functioning of diesel engines. It removes contaminants from diesel fuel before it reaches the engine. Clean fuel ensures combustion is efficient, leading to better fuel economy. A high-quality diesel filter also helps prevent wear on engine components, extending their life.

Gas Filters Explained

What is a Gas Filter?

Gas filters serve a similar purpose for gasoline engines. They filter out dirt, rust, and other harmful particles. This process is crucial for maintaining clean fuel entering the engine. While gas engines may have fewer contaminants compared to diesel, using a proper gas filter remains important.

Function and Benefits of Gas Filters

A gas filter helps ensure your fuel injectors do not become clogged. Clogs can lead to poor engine performance and decreased efficiency. Regular maintenance of gas filters guarantees that your engine runs smoothly. This attention to detail is vital for any gasoline-powered vehicle owner.

Key Differences Between Diesel and Gas Filters

Filtration Process

The filtration process varies between diesel and gas filters. Diesel filters often possess finer filtration capabilities. This is necessary because diesel fuel generally carries more impurities. The ability to capture these particles prevents larger contaminants from damaging the engine.

Design and Construction

Diesel filters are typically built to handle greater pressure and larger volumes. This is due to the nuances of diesel fuel systems, which operate differently from gas engines. A gas filter, by contrast, generally has a simpler design, tailored for lighter fuel.

Maintenance and Replacement Needs

Maintenance requirements differ significantly between the two types. Diesel filters usually require more frequent replacement. This is because they filter out more contaminants. Gas filters may have longer replacement intervals, but neglecting them can lead to significant engine issues.

How to Choose the Right Filter

Assess Your Vehicle Needs

To determine whether you need a diesel filter or a gas filter, first assess your vehicle. Consider the engine type and the fuel used. Vehicles running on diesel obviously require a diesel filter, while gas vehicles need gas filters.

Frequency of Replacement

Understand the manufacturer’s recommendations for filter replacement. Regularly check your vehicle’s manual for specific guidelines. Adhering to these recommendations can enhance your engine’s performance.
